1. Jacks or Better

Jacks or Better is arguably the most well-known video poker variant. The gameplay is straightforward: players aim to form a winning hand with a pair of jacks or higher. This variant balances the potential for payouts and the odds, making it ideal for both beginners and seasoned players. With a return-to-player (RTP) percentage of around 99.54%, it’s no wonder this game is a favorite in Swedish establishments.

2. Deuces Wild

Another popular variant is Deuces Wild, where all twos act as wild cards, allowing players to substitute them for any other cards to form a winning hand. This unlimited potential for creating strong combinations makes Deuces Wild exciting. Its RTP can reach up to 100.76% when played with optimal strategy, which is enticing for players looking for high returns.

3. Joker Poker

Joker Poker introduces a wild card into the mix, which is a joker in this variant. Players can use the joker to replace any card, significantly increasing the chances of forming a winning hand. The gameplay has various payout schedules depending on the strength of the hand, making it captivating for those who enjoy calculating risks. The RTP for this game can be around 98.50%, depending on the paytable.

4. Aces and Eights

Aces and Eights stands out with its unique payout structure, offering higher rewards for four of a kind with eights and aces. This variant has gained a significant following in Sweden, primarily due to its lucrative payouts for premium hands. With an RTP of approximately 99.78%, it is a great choice for players looking to maximize their returns while enjoying the classic video poker format.

5. Tens or Better

Similar to Jacks or Better, Tens or Better requires players to form a winning hand of tens or higher. This variant is particularly appealing to novice players due to its simple rules and the near-identical gameplay. With an RTP that rivals that of Jacks or Better, this game provides an enjoyable experience for those looking to test their luck and skill.
